Mexican tomatoes: 99% come here. The Wall Street Journal doesn’t mention it was NAFTA that gutted U.S. tomato farms. Our negotiators traded them away in favor of corn, soy and pork…a good deal, but a reminder there have long been winners and losers. Political clout matters. wsj.com/economy/tomato…

48%. How much our fluid milk consumption has dropped in 48 years…1975 to 2023. Less than 20% of milk produced is consumed as fluid milk, while 40+ percent goes into cheese. #dairymonth #makeminemilk #milkdoesabodygood
